The odds:

Floyd Mayweather was set as a -200 favorite in this fight not long ago, meaning you would have to risk $200 to make $100 on a Mayweather wager. Since then, the betting public has showed strong support for the underdog Manny Pacquiao, which has moved his odds from around +200 to +162. So, a $100 Pacquaio bet would win you $162 at this current price.
